The expansions "The Frozen Horror" and "Wizards of Morcar" both feature Men-at-Arms. The rules for each expansion explain in detail how Heroes hire and pay for such henchmen, and the cards detail their stats. They mostly play how you would expect them to, although the cards by themselves don't indicate that the cost to keep an employed Man-at-Arms from the end of one Quest to the beginning of the next is a mere 10 gold coins, rather than paying their initial purchase price each time.

Also, depending on which source you reference, the Swordsman will have either 4 or 5 defend dice. I play him with 5, but it's up to you.

In WoM: Twelve max. Four max for each hero. Six max of each type. Each cost 10gp to keep between quests.

75gp Swordsman: M4 A4 D5 B1 M2
75gp Crossbowman: M6 A2* D3 B1 M2 *=May be ranged.
50gp Halberdier: M6 A3 D3 B1 M2
50gp Scout: M8 A2 D3 B1 M2 May search for traps and secret doors.


The US rules are different. They're hired for one quest, to be kept they have to pay the full price again. Not sure how many they can have each.

100gp Swordsman: M5 A4 D5 B2 M2
75gp Crossbowman: M6 A3* D3 B2 M2 *=May be ranged.
75gp Halberdier: M6 A3* D3 B2 M2 *=May be diagonal.
50gp Scout: M9 A2 D3 B2 M2 May search for traps and disarm them like the Dwarf (slightly different rules in the US version).

In the US rules traps and secret doors is a separate search, they have to be on the trapped square to disarm it and the dwarf sets off the trap on the roll of a black shield.

Incidentally the US mercenaries prove that ranged weapons can't be used against diagonally adjacent targets or US halberdiers would be pointless.

No, that would simply be a crossbowman that costs 25gp more. The extra 25 is for that ability. I don't think it needs to cost more, most of the time it's not useful because you'll need to move to be able to shoot.

Look at it like this. One bowman costs the same as two halberdiers, who between them can attack twice with three dice and get two BP (although they can only attack once after losing the first BP). One bowman can attack at range but has one BP, attacks with two dice and can attack twice on occasion, and you want to take their two shot ability away?

What you should do though is play that you can't do anything else when shooting twice so that bowmen can't be used to open doors and get two shots, that would make them too effective. I forgot about that.

100gp Bowman: M6 A2* D3 B1 M2 *=May be ranged and can shoot twice if you do nothing else that turn.
